1985 Holden Gemini vs. 1988 Acura Integra
To start off, 1988 Acura Integra is newer by 3 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1985 Holden Gemini.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1985 Holden Gemini would be higher. At 1,500 cc (4 cylinders), 1988 Acura Integra is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1988 Acura Integra (113 HP) has 41 more horse power than 1985 Holden Gemini. (72 HP) In normal driving conditions, 1988 Acura Integra should accelerate faster than 1985 Holden Gemini.
Both vehicles are front wheel drive (FWD). Which offers better traction when its slippery than rear w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. 1988 Acura Integra has automatic transmission and 1985 Holden Gemini has manual transmission. 1985 Holden Gemini will offer better control over acceleration and deceleration in addition to better fuel efficiency overall. 1988 Acura Integra will be easier to drive especially in heavy traffic.
Compare all specifications:
1985 Holden Gemini | 1988 Acura Integra | |
Make | Holden | Acura |
Model | Gemini | Integra |
Year Released | 1985 | 1988 |
Engine Position | Front | Front |
Engine Size | 1471 cc | 1500 cc |
Engine Cylinders | 4 cylinders | 4 cylinders |
Engine Type | in-line | in-line |
Horse Power | 72 HP | 113 HP |
Fuel Type | Gasoline | Gasoline |
Drive Type | Front | Front |
Transmission Type | Manual | Automatic |
Vehicle Length | 4040 mm | 4285 mm |
Vehicle Width | 1610 mm | 1665 mm |
Vehicle Height | 1380 mm | 1290 mm |
Wheelbase Size | 2410 mm | 2450 mm |
